Step1: Find the third angle
The sum of angles in a triangle is \(180^{\circ}\). Let the third angle be \(A\). Then \(A = 180^{\circ}-40^{\circ}-110^{\circ}=30^{\circ}\).
Step2: Apply the Law of Sines
The Law of Sines states that \(\frac{a}{\sin A}=\frac{b}{\sin B}\). Here, if we assume the side of length \(7\) is opposite the \(30^{\circ}\) angle and side \(x\) is opposite the \(110^{\circ}\) angle. So \(\frac{7}{\sin 30^{\circ}}=\frac{x}{\sin 110^{\circ}}\).
Since \(\sin 30^{\circ}=\frac{1}{2}\), the equation becomes \(x = 7\times\frac{\sin 110^{\circ}}{\sin 30^{\circ}}\).
We know that \(\sin 110^{\circ}=\sin(90^{\circ} + 20^{\circ})=\cos 20^{\circ}\approx0.94\).
Substituting the values: \(x = 7\times\frac{0.94}{0.5}=7\times1.88 = 13.2\).
